Pyramid is getting a lot of striper boils right now. Castaic has been really slow, been about a week since I was there last. I don't really fish the lagoon all that often.

We do do a lot of saltwater on the cattle boats. I love taking the kids out to the channel islands, they wind up landing a lot more fish. I know Dana Wharf is running specials right now, 2 for 1 on Tuesdays and $25 per person on twilight boats. Have you ever thought about taking them out? How old are they?
